Designing with Purpose and Style
One of the most important aspects of using Picado in a commercial setting is understanding how it pairs with other typefaces. Because it is so bold and colorful, it needs support from more neutral fonts. I found that pairing it with a clean sans serif font works beautifully for body copy on packaging or website descriptions. This combination ensures readability while letting the display font take center stage.
For a softer, more romantic look, such as on wedding invitations or greeting cards, I paired it with a delicate script font. The contrast between the structured geometry of Picado and the fluid motion of a handwritten font creates a balanced composition. You might also try combining it with a simple serif font for a touch of classic elegance. This versatility makes it an essential asset for any designer looking to build a strong brand identity.
When designing for merchandise like mugs, shirts, or signs, consider the scale. On a large farmhouse sign, the font commands attention. On a small mug label, it requires careful spacing to remain legible. Always test your designs in grayscale first to ensure the contrast holds up before committing to the full-color version. This step is crucial for maintaining clarity across different production methods.
Technical Considerations for Makers
Before diving into a large production run, it is vital to check the included styles, alternates, ligatures, and swashes. Picado offers a variety of weights and character options that allow for endless customization. If you are selling physical products, verify the commercial font licensing terms to ensure you are covered for mass production. Most modern typefaces come with clear guidelines for digital downloads and print-on-demand services, but double-checking protects your business.
File formats matter, especially for SVG users. Ensure your software supports the specific color layers provided in the font file. Multilingual support is another feature to explore if you plan to sell internationally. The ability to adapt the font for different languages can open up new markets for your handmade goods.
